California Updates Tax Delinquent List
- Oct 18, 2013 | Gail Cole

The State Board of Equalization has updated its list of Top 500 Sales and Use Tax Delinquencies in California. The last list was published in June.
It's no honor to make the list. In fact, it's the reverse. California hopes that by publicizing the list of top delinquent taxpayers, they will be shamed into paying what they owe. It seems to work; since the inception of The List of Shame, more than 100 delinquent taxpayers have coughed up over $9 million of taxes owed.
